BYD Seal 06 EV to be launched on Jun 7

BYD Seal 06 EV to be launched on Jun 7

0
The Seal 06 EV will be launched on the first day of the Chongqing auto show on June 7, following its pre-sales at the Shenzhen auto show on May 31.

China Warns BYD, Rivals to Self-Regulate on Price War Woes

China Warns BYD, Rivals to Self-Regulate on Price War Woes

0
(Bloomberg) -- Chinese officials summoned the heads of major electric vehicle makers, including BYD Co., to Beijing earlier this week to address concerns about the long-running price war, according to people familiar with the matter.
